Compatibility with Processors

The ASRock Intel Core Ultra Z890 supports Intel Core Ultra processors (Series 2) with an LGA1851 socket. This motherboard is designed to leverage the latest technology from Intel, ensuring compatibility with cutting-edge CPUs. On the other hand, the GIGABYTE B550M AORUS Elite AX features an AMD AM4 socket and is compatible with Ryzen 5000, 4000, and 3000 series processors. This broad support for AMD processors positions the GIGABYTE motherboard as a versatile option for users looking to build or upgrade their systems using AMD's range of CPUs.

Power Delivery and Efficiency

Power delivery is crucial for system stability and performance. The ASRock motherboard boasts a robust 12+1+1+1+1 power phase design with a 110A SPS for VCore, which suggests it is engineered for high performance and stability during intensive tasks. Conversely, the GIGABYTE B550M features a 5+3 power phase design with premium chokes and capacitors, which ensures steady power delivery for its supported processors. While both designs aim to provide reliable power, the ASRock’s more complex setup is likely to appeal to users seeking superior overclocking capabilities and performance under load.

Memory Support

In terms of memory, the ASRock motherboard supports dual-channel DDR5 memory with speeds up to 9466 MHz (OC) and can accommodate up to 128 GB. This high memory capacity and speed make it an excellent choice for users who require substantial RAM for demanding applications. The GIGABYTE B550M, however, supports DDR4 memory and can handle up to four DIMMs, enhancing its flexibility. While its maximum memory speed isn’t specified, DDR4 typically operates at lower frequencies compared to DDR5. Users prioritizing high-speed memory for gaming or professional workloads might lean towards the ASRock option.

Connectivity Options

Connectivity is another essential factor to consider. The ASRock Intel Core Ultra Z890 provides diverse graphics output options, including one HDMI and two Thunderbolt 4 Type-C ports, catering to modern display needs. Additionally, it features BIOS Flashback and Memory OC Shield for user-friendly performance enhancements. In contrast, the GIGABYTE B550M AORUS Elite AX offers comprehensive connectivity with PCIe 4.0 support, two M.2 slots, and USB 3.2 ports for faster data transfer. While both motherboards provide good connectivity, the GIGABYTE’s emphasis on PCIe 4.0 and multiple M.2 slots may appeal more to users looking for speed in storage solutions.

Thermal Management

Thermal management plays a vital role in maintaining system performance. The ASRock motherboard is designed for stability and efficiency, which likely includes adequate thermal solutions, though specific features are not detailed. The GIGABYTE B550M, however, includes advanced thermal armor with an enlarged MOSFET heatsink, ensuring better heat dissipation. This emphasis on thermal management makes the GIGABYTE motherboard suitable for users who may be running demanding applications or overclocking their CPUs, as it helps maintain optimal operating temperatures.

User Experience and Features

For user experience, the ASRock motherboard emphasizes stability, durability, and efficiency, making it suitable for everyday computing tasks. It also offers user-friendly features like BIOS Flashback. The GIGABYTE B550M stands out with its DIY-friendly design, featuring Q-Flash Plus for easy BIOS upgrades without needing to install the CPU, RAM, or GPU. This focus on ease of use may attract novice builders or those looking for a straightforward assembly experience, highlighting the GIGABYTE’s practical advantages for DIY projects.
